Abstract
Thirty-three spectral lines of chromium atom in the blue-violet region (425–465 nm) have been investigated with the method of laser-induced resonance fluorescence on an atomic beam. For all the lines, the isotope shifts for every pair of chromium isotopes have been determined. The lines can be divided into six groups, according to the configuration of the upper and lower levels. Electronic factors of the field shift and the specific mass shift (Fik and MikSMS, respectively) have been evaluated and the values for each pure configuration involved have been determined. Comparison of the values Fik and MikSMS to the ab initio calculations results has been performed. The presence of crossed second order (CSO) effects has been observed.
